British rocker PETE DOHERTY was allowed to miss a court hearing on Wednesday to play a gig because the judge is a fan of his music.
The Babyshambles frontman was due to appear in court for a progress review following a drugs rehabilitation order but Judge Jane McIvor adjourned the hearing until Wednesday to allow him to attend a concert in Paris.
Judge McIvor once praised Doherty’s song The Blinding, telling the court, "It is a good tune, but I'm not so sure about the lyrics."
